Responsibilities:
  • Provide skilled nursing care and support to hospice patients in accordance with state guidelines and hospice policies.
  • Perform comprehensive patient assessments, develop individualized plans of care, and revise care plans as needed.
  • Manage an assigned caseload of patients, coordinating care across disciplines to ensure quality and continuity.
  • Complete admissions by performing initial assessments, verifying hospice eligibility, educating patients/families, and initiating the plan of care.
  • Administer medications, treatments, and procedures as prescribed.
  • Educate patients and families on symptom management, disease progression, and end-of-life care.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for patients, families, and healthcare providers regarding care coordination and clinical updates.
  • Maintain accurate, timely clinical documentation in compliance with regulatory and organizational standards.
  • Participate in interdisciplinary team meetings to ensure collaborative care planning.
  • Support patients and families emotionally, advocating for patient comfort, dignity, and informed decision-making.
Qualifications:
  • Graduate of an accredited School of Nursing; current RN licensure in the state.
  • Current CPR certification.
  • Minimum one (1) year recent nursing experience; hospice or palliative care experience preferred.
  • Experience with case management and/or hospice admissions strongly preferred.
  • Strong clinical, assessment, organizational,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in home and facility settings.
  • Capable of meeting the physical demands of patient care (e.g., lifting, positioning, standing, walking).
  • Must have a valid driver’s license, reliable insured vehicle, and meet organization driving requirements.
